Rated 1 out of 5 stars

Disappointed – quality far below expectations

We have been coming to Tenerife for years and unfortunately noticed a decline in standards, but this hotel has been by far the worst experience.

Food
The food was unacceptable for a hotel advertised as 4-star. The variety was extremely limited and repetitive, with very little fresh fish and almost no local products (not even bananas, which is surprising in Tenerife). The buffet feels unmanaged, with no balance or quality control.
There were no proper food labels. On the rare occasions when something was labelled, the ingredients did not match what was written. This creates confusion and makes it unreliable for anyone with allergies or dietary requirements. Overall, it gave the impression that there is no food consultant or professional oversight.

Cleanliness
Cleaning standards were equally poor. Tables and children’s highchairs were wiped with the same cloth that had a strong unpleasant smell. Rooms were only superficially cleaned. Toiletries were diluted – the shower gel was mixed with so much water it barely produced any foam.

Service & Management
There was no effort from management to collect feedback or improve guest experience. The overall service felt neglected and careless.

This hotel does not meet 4-star standards and leaves the impression of being either poorly managed or facing financial issues. Unfortunately, nothing about the stay is worth remembering in a positive way. We would not return and cannot recommend it.

Rated 2 out of 5 stars

Hotel on a big hill 😁

As with the my other review about the flights from Norwich I should’ve checked more about the position of this hotel especially as I was there celebrating my 70th birthday.
On arrival at this hotel I thought we had picked a good one but then I saw the stairs everywhere. I couldn’t believe it when I opened the door of our apartment to see it was on two floors. Bedroom and bathroom on bottom floor and front door , another bedroom and kitchen on top floor. Me being dense didn’t know what a duplex apartment was.
We weren’t too bad with the outside stairs where our rooms were but because the hotel is built on a huge hill the buildings are staggered uphill and laying beside the pool the next day on the uncomfortable loungers we could see these people climbing this massive flight of stairs. There might’ve been lifts but we weren’t over that side so didn’t find out.
On the hotel description it says bus shuttle service to beach which I thought would be a fairly regular service during the day but there is only one bus leaving hotel about 10.45 and then one coming back about 17.00 (might’ve been later I can’t remember). We had enough by about 14.30 so had to get taxi back.
There is nothing near the hotel, if you want to go to a bar outside the hotel it is a good hike away and then coming back it is all uphill so anyone who isn’t fit, or probably even those that are fit, it’s a taxi ride especially back.
Apart from that the hotel isn’t bad. The food was good, evening entertainment wasn’t too bad but mostly catering for the children. Adults get about an hour, roughly 21.30 until 22.30, way too short. The drinks weren’t too bad but I did go to bed sober every night 😁
Staff are fantastic and work very hard and rooms are kept really clean

Rated 5 out of 5 stars

Great array of food and drink, friendly staff and kids entertainment… highly recommend

Really enjoyed our time here. The all inclusive was perfect for us with 3 kids. It meant they could go and help themselves to snacks and mocktails and slushes whenever they fancied during the day. We rarely left the resort and when we did we fitted it round meal times as there was so much on offer. The majority of food was delicious with a huge array of options. Different themed dinners each night was a bonus. The drinks on offer were plenty with local beer being Dorada and local Sangria and an array of all inclusive cocktails. Certain extra cocktails came at a price but we didn’t need them. The kids mini disco was a huge hit with the kids as was the kids entertainment during the day. Although it states you can’t drop and leave we happily let our kids run off to the activities whilst we lounged nearby. The entertainment staff were a huge credit to the hotel.they were attentive, caring, kind and made a real effort to remember all the kids names. Three pools to choose from were perfect for a varied ages of children in our group. Just be careful in the floor when wet as you could deck it. The foam party on Wednesdays was a huge hit as was the daily aqua fit. The staff were super friendly and were really welcoming to the kids. Always praising them when they tried to speak a bit of Spanish if only to tell them our room number in Spanish. The room was clean and we had an abundance of towels as well as our pool towels provided. The steep marble steps in the room could prove slightly dangerous with young kids, we just made sure to lay a bench across it at nighttime to prevent any unwanted walking round from our kids and potential accidents. Would highly recommend this hotel.

Rated 5 out of 5 stars

Excellent hotel

Excellent hotel. Lovely hardworking, polite and helpful staff. The duplex suites (all are duplex from what we could see) were roomy, with two levels. One level with bathroom, large bedroom (with tv- with bbc and itv)and patio with sun loungers. The upstairs had a kitchen, large lounge (with tv)and balcony.
Cleaners came in everyday.
We stayed all inclusive. The food was excellent and we thought there was a good variety.
We were able to use Wi-Fi anywhere within the resort, including our apartment.
There was entertainment throughout the day for adults (if they wanted to join in) and for children.
The evening entertainment was enjoyable and started with inclusive awards for the children whether or not they had participated in the games during the day.
All in all it was a great resort. The only thing that spoilt it was the rude guests, who would get up at the crack of dawn and put their towels on the best sun beds.
I would recommend that the hotel advise guests on arrival to the hotel, that they are not allowed to lay their towels on the beds before 9am, unless they are going to lay on them. Often the beds lay empty, with towels on, until late morning.

Rated 3 out of 5 stars

Not a four star hotel

This hotel is not four stars. The interior is nice - not as pretty as in the photos - but overall the design of the hotel and the rooms were a 4 star standard. The pool area is far too small and we had to take our luggage by ourselves with three small children after a long flight through people in their swimsuits and slippery floor to our rooms which initially were hard to find. This part was not that professional. Overall the staff attitude was amazing and everyone was very welcoming and professional. Room cleaning was very mediocre and they would only change our sheets when we asked them - and with small children they get dirty quickly. They changed our pool towels once! You have TO PAY to get your towels changed - even though this is meant to be ALL INCLUSIVE. You also have TO PAY FOR A MOJITO! You also have to pay for a bottle of water after you have had your complimentary bottle in your fridge. This is not an all inclusive hotel - I don't care what they claim it's just not. Also there were cockroaches in the bathroom from time to time - although you cant really blame the hotel for that. My biggest complaint would be the food. Same thing for breakfast everyday - a low standard english breakfast buffet. The only things I could say I really liked was the mushroom sauce and surprisingly the sushi when they made it once. They also dont salt anything - very annoying. And you eat food from trays as if you are in school again. This honestly just made me feel very stupid. Final thing, the company that this hotel attracts were not very civilised- people constantly waking us up with their drunken shouts, the family next to me put their husband not he balcony to sleep and several people made complaints about it to the point security had to give him a warning for all the noise he was making. Some people kept ringing at my parents room in the middle of the night all drunk which is obviously very annoying to be woken up especially when you have toddlers that need sleep! This isn't necessarily the hotels fault but that just shows you the kind of people that stay here. All in all the hotel was alright - compared to other hotels Ive been to it was not very good but for those people that like the chavy atmosphere and who dont go on many holidays then this will be alright for you. It's just not a four star hotel - ITS THREE!
